Lake Buchanan Guide Report

LAKE BUCHANAN: Water clear; 84 degrees; 1017.25’: Largemouth to 4 lbs. are fair early in 8’-15’ on 1/8 oz. Silver Shad Terminator buzzbaits(www.terminatorlures.com), 1/4 oz. Rat-L-Traps(www.rat-l-trap.com) and 6" watermelon/red Scoundrel worms(www.cremelure.com) on Whacky rigs worked around boat docks. Stripers are good on Hyper Striper jigs (www.kgenterprise.com) and tightlining live bait in 25’-30’ of water along mainlake points near the dam early and late in the day. Some topwater activity at daylight with fish in the 18’'-22" inch range. White Bass are slow along creek points jigging 1/4 oz. Pirk Minnows, 2" Lit’l Fishie Shads, chrome Tiny Traps early.
